What Malware.AI.4230203603 virus can do?

  • Injection (inter-process)
  • Injection (Process Hollowing)
  • Executable code extraction
  • Attempts to connect to a dead IP:Port (2 unique times)
  • Creates RWX memory
  • Drops a binary and executes it
  • HTTP traffic contains suspicious features which may be indicative of malware related traffic
  • Performs some HTTP requests
  • Uses Windows utilities for basic functionality
  • Executed a process and injected code into it, probably while unpacking
  • Creates a hidden or system file
  • Attempts to modify proxy settings
  • Creates a copy of itself
